  <hadith number="6184" global_number="6184">
    <collection>Sahih al-Bukhari</collection>
    <book>To make the Heart Tender (Ar-Riqaq)</book>
    <narrators>
      <narrator>&apos;Utban bin Malik Al-Ansari</narrator>
    </narrators>
    <grade>Sahih</grade>
    <text>who was one of the men of the tribe of Bani Salim: Allah’s Messenger (ﷺ) came to me and said, “If anybody comes on the Day of Resurrection who has said: La ilaha illal-lah, sincerely, with the intention to win Allah’s Pleasure, Allah will make the Hell-Fire forbidden for him.”</text>

  <hadith number="1950" global_number="9227">
    <collection>Sahih Muslim</collection>
    <book>The Book of Prayer - Two Eids</book>
    <narrators>
      <narrator>&apos;Utban bin Malik Al-Ansari</narrator>
    </narrators>
    <grade>Sahih</grade>
    <text>‘Umar b. Khattab asked me what the Messenger of Allah (ﷺ) recited on ‘Id day. I said:” The Hour drew near” and Qaf. By the Glorious Qur’an”.</text>
